Leona Helmsley, the hotel owner and real estate investor who died last week at age 87, left no uncertainty about the future of her fortune, estimated at more than $4 billion. Helmsleys will also included $15 million for her (now deceased) brother, Alvin Rosenthal and $10 million each for two of her grandsons, David Panzirer and Walter Panzirer; two other grandchildren, Craig Panzirer and Meegan Panzirer Wesolko, were initially disinherited but later each received $3 million. Helmsley died at 87 on Aug. 20, 2007, and was interred next to her husband, Harry, in a family mausoleum in Sleepy Hollow Cemetery in Westchester. Harry, born in 1909 and raised in the Bronx, was sixteen when he joined a small Manhattan real-estate firm as an office boy for twelve dollars a week, and soon worked his way into a partnership. Born in 1920, she overcame a hardscrabble youth in Brooklyn to become a successful condominium broker in Manhattan, eventually alighting, in the nineteen-sixties, at a firm owned by Harry B. Helmsley, one of the citys biggest real-estate developers. In her will, Leona Helmsley was more generous to two of her grandchildren, David and Walter Panzirer, who were left trusts and bequests worth ten million dollars, on the condition that they visit their fathers grave at least once a year. Thanks in part to the efforts of the members of Hoffmans alliance to foster adoptions and spaying and neutering, the percentage of animals killed in New York City shelters has dropped from seventy-four per cent, in 2002, to forty-three per cent, in 2007. The lawyers submitted affidavits from such animal experts as Jane Goodall, who said that chimpanzees are biochemically closer to humans than they are to any other of the great apes. According to the brief in the case, the chimps are capable of rational thought, communication, and other higher cognitive functions, justifying their treatment as the legal equivalent of minors or disabled humans. A network of lawyers and animal activists has orchestrated these changes, largely without opposition, in order to whittle down the legal distinctions between human beings and animals.
